Oxnard College vs. San Diego Mesa College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, Oxnard College or San Diego Mesa College? Published tuition is the sticker price; many students pay less after aid (see average net price below).

  • The typical actual cost that students pay to attend (average net price) is less at Oxnard College than San Diego Mesa College ($1,085 vs. $10,316).
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at Oxnard College are 29.3% lower than at San Diego Mesa College ($22,086 vs. $31,243).
  • Oxnard College is 24.4% more expensive for in-state tuition than San Diego Mesa College (about $280 more per year; $1,426.00 vs. $1,146.00).
  • Out-of-state tuition is 4% higher at San Diego Mesa College than at Oxnard College (about $387 more per year; $10,002.00 vs. $9,615.00).
  • A larger share of students receive grant aid at Oxnard College than at San Diego Mesa College (95% vs. 79%).
  • The average total grant financial aid received by San Diego Mesa College students is 0.8% larger than aid received by Oxnard College students ($8,252 vs. $8,183).

Oxnard College vs. San Diego Mesa College Graduation Outcomes Comparison

How do outcomes compare for Oxnard College and San Diego Mesa College? Graduation rate, earnings, and student loan debt are common indicators. The bullets below summarize the same federal outcomes fields as the comparison table (College Scorecard / IPEDS where applicable).

  • Graduates from San Diego Mesa College earn a median of about $8,500 more per year than Oxnard College graduates about ten years after starting college ($41,600 vs. $33,100), per the same Scorecard earnings definition.
